The perfect time to enjoy cherries

From April to July is the perfect period of time to taste cherries, with the optimum time being between mid-May and mid-June. This fruit is known for its delicious sweet and juicy taste, being a favorite of both children and adults. Although the season is coming to an end, we can still enjoy it at its best.

The benefits of consuming cherries

The consumption of cherries provides several benefits for our body. This fruit, available only during the harvesting season, is fresh par excellence and offers properties that can be a remedy with medicinal values ​​to combat everyday problems. Cherries are rich in vitamins A and C, as well as containing essential minerals such as phosphorus, calcium, potassium and magnesium. They also provide phytonutrients with an antioxidant effect that protect cells, minimizing the risk of heart disease and other serious problems.

Anti-inflammatory properties

Cherries contain anthocyanins, plant pigments that exert a beneficial anti-inflammatory effect to relieve muscle pain after intense exercise. In addition, this analgesic effect can help prevent arterial stiffness, hypercholesterolemia, as well as other diseases such as arthritis, low back pain and gout.

Elimination of toxins and regulation of sleep

Consuming cherries has the ability to eliminate toxic substances stored in key organs such as the liver and gall bladder. Cherries also contain melatonin, a hormone that regulates sleep cycles, helping to improve rest and the immune system.

Recommended quantity

Despite the benefits, it is important not to abuse the consumption of cherries. It is recommended not to exceed the equivalent of one cup a day, approximately 15 cherries, as excessive consumption can cause adverse effects such as diarrhea, bloating and cramps.
